William Stroud was a staff worker at Los Alamos during the Manhattan Project.
Thomas V. Moore was the chief engineer of the University of Chicago Met Lab and oversaw the construction of Chicago Pile-1.
Jim Eckles worked for decades for the White Sands Missile Range Public Affairs Office, managing open houses and tours of the Trinity site, where the world’s first nuclear test took place.
Earl E. Sanders served in the 1027th Air Materials Squadron.
